In this episode of The Artistic Vision podcast, hosts Gary and Alex talk with Robert Balfour, a priest, woodworker, and founder of the Old School Makerspace in San Antonio, Texas. Together, they explore the intersection of faith and art, showing how creativity can become a unique form of ministry. Robert shares his personal story of moving from a practical, no-nonsense upbringing to discovering the transformative power of beauty and craftsmanship. Through woodworking, he found not only a personal spiritual practice but also a way to foster collaboration, creativity, and growth within his church and local community. Listeners will discover how a makerspace can serve as an expression of faith, bringing people together to create, connect, and be transformed.
